Historical & Cultural Background

In Irish culture, Enya is derived from the name Eithne, which signifies 'kernel' or 'grain' and is often associated with warmth and fire. In Japan, the name Enya can be linked to musical connotations, reflecting a cultural appreciation for art and harmony.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Enya was first seen in the United States in 1989. Enya has ranked as high as #1213 nationally, which occurred in 2002, and has been most popular in California, Texas, New York, Pennsylvania, and Florida. In the past 5 years the name Enya has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
